Where does “minnismerki” come from?

minnismerki (Icelandic) comes from Icelandic minni, from Old Norse minni, from Proto-Germanic minnizô, from Proto-Indo-European mey- — to strengthen; to bind; to change, exchange.

minnismerki (Icelandic): memorial, monument

Definitions

  1. memorial, monument
